The Payer Reality Behind a Sioux Falls Anesthesia Claim

Sioux Falls bills a payer mix that reflects its regional-hub role. South Dakota runs its Medicaid program largely on a fee-for-service basis rather than through competing managed-care organizations, so those claims follow a single state ruleset — cleaner in theory, but unforgiving when a modifier or authorization is off. Alongside that sits a heavy commercial book, a growing Medicare share, and a meaningful volume of out-of-state patients whose plans have to be verified before the case, because Sanford and Avera both draw referrals across four state lines.

That cross-border draw is the quiet revenue risk here. An anesthesia group can code a case perfectly and still stall it if a patient from western Minnesota or northwest Iowa carries a plan that was never verified for out-of-state coverage. A professional partner that confirms eligibility across state lines and bills South Dakota Medicaid on its own fee-for-service edits keeps the regional caseload paying instead of aging.

What Drives a Sioux Falls Anesthesia Claim

Anesthesia is priced on units, then multiplied by the payer's contracted rate. Every Sioux Falls claim runs on (ASA base units + time units + modifier units) × the payer's conversion factor, with time documented in 15-minute increments from recorded start and stop times.

Claim componentWhat it means on a Sioux Falls case
ASA base unitsSet by the anesthesia CPT (00100–01999); each procedure carries its own base value
Time unitsDocumented start/stop, billed in 15-minute increments
Physical-status modifierP1–P6 by acuity; documented from the pre-op record
Medical-direction modifiersAA, QK (2–4 concurrent), QY (one CRNA), QX (CRNA directed), QZ (CRNA non-directed), AD (>4 rooms)
MAC / QSMonitored anesthesia care flagged with QS plus documented medical necessity
Conversion factorApplied per contract — commercial plans, Noridian Medicare, and South Dakota Medicaid each differ

On medically directed cases, the TEFRA seven steps must all be documented, or the directed modifier drops to a lower non-directed rate. Across two large systems staffing concurrent CRNA rooms, that documentation discipline is where the revenue is protected.

Where Sioux Falls Anesthesia Practices Lose Revenue

In a referral hub with a cross-border patient base, the leaks concentrate on eligibility, time capture, and medical-direction accuracy.

Leak

Out-of-state eligibility not verified

The denial or loss it triggers

Claim denied for coverage or network

How we prevent it

Confirm multi-state benefits before the case

Leak

Missing or incorrect time units

The denial or loss it triggers

Underpayment — case value cut roughly in half

How we prevent it

Reconcile start/stop against the anesthesia record

Leak

Medical-direction modifier mismatch (QK/QX ratio)

The denial or loss it triggers

Direction denied; paid at a lower rate

How we prevent it

Verify concurrency and TEFRA compliance per case

Leak

South Dakota Medicaid edit errors

The denial or loss it triggers

Fee-for-service claim held or denied

How we prevent it

Bill Medicaid cases on the state's own edits

Leak

MAC without documented necessity

The denial or loss it triggers

QS line denied

How we prevent it

Confirm and attach medical-necessity support

Leak

NCCI bundling with the surgeon's global

The denial or loss it triggers

Line denied as included in the procedure

How we prevent it

Screen edits so anesthesia bills separately
